In this course, you will learn the fundamentals of using IBM SPSS Statistics for typical data analysis process. You will learn the basics of reading data, data definition, data modification, as well as data analysis and presentation of analytical results. You will also see how easy it is to get data into IBM SPSS Statistics so that you can focus on analyzing the information. In addition to learning the fundamentals, you will get to know shortcuts that will help you save time. This course uses the IBM SPSS Statistics Base features.

There are no prerequisites for this course.

1. Introduction to IBM SPSS Statistics

  • How IBM SPSS Statistics is used for basic analysis
  • Basic steps in data analysis
  • primary windows in IBM SPSS Statistics
  • different components of dialog boxes

2. Reading Data

  • Import data from different types of file formats
  • choices on the File menu for reading data
  • Read Microsoft Excel files
  • Read files from a Microsoft Access database
  • Read delimited text files

3. Defining Variable Properties

  • variable properties in the Variable View window
  • Use the Define Variable Properties dialog box
  • Save variable properties with data in an IBM SPSS Statistics data file
  • Use the Variables utility to view variable properties interactively
  • Use the Display Data Dictionary facility and the Codebook procedure to view variable properties

4. Working with the Data Editor

  • Use features in the Data Editor
  • Insert, delete, and move variables and cases
  • Use the Split Screen view
  • Copy information from one dataset to another
  • Use the Copy Data Properties feature

5. Modifying Data Values: Recode

  • Use Visual Binning to reclassify values of an ordinal or scale variable
  • Use Recode Into a Different Variable to reclassify values of a nominal variable
  • Use Automatic Recode to create a numeric variable from a string variable

6. Modifying Data Values: Compute

  • features of Compute Variable
  • Create new variables with numeric expressions
  • Create new variables with conditional numeric expressions

7. Summarizing Individual Variables

  • Levels of measurement
  • Use the Frequencies procedure to produce tables and charts appropriate for nominal variables
  • Use the Frequencies procedure to produce tables and charts appropriate for ordinal variables
  • Use the Frequencies and Descriptives procedure to produce tables and charts for scale variables

8. Relationships between Variables

  • Select the appropriate procedure to summarize the relationship between two variables
  • Use the Crosstabs procedure to summarize the relationship between categorical variables
  • Use the Means procedure to summarize the relationship between a scale and a categorical variable

9. Selecting Cases for Analyses

  • Select cases in a data file using various methods
  • Use the features of the Select Cases dialog box
  • Use the features of the Split File dialog box

10. Creating and Editing Charts

  • Present results with charts
  • Use the Chart Builder to create various types of graphs
  • Format and edit graphs in the Chart Editor

11. Working in the Viewer

  • Navigate through the Viewer
  • Perform Automated Output Modification
  • Customize a pivot table
  • Create and apply a template for a pivot table
  • Export output to other applications

12. Syntax Basics

  • Use basic syntax to automate analyses
  • Use the Syntax Editor environment
  • Create syntax
  • Run syntax
  • Edit syntax

13. Menus and the Help System

  • Use the menus
  • Use the Toolbars
  • Use all types of help in IBM SPSS Statistics

The Nordic country Norway, is in Northern Europe. Known for its stunning natural beauty, including fjords, mountains, and forests, Norway is also famous for its high standard of living and strong social welfare system. Norway's capital and largest city is Oslo. Tromsø, Bergen, Trondheim and Stavanger are the other tourist attracting cities of Norway.

Norway is a constitutional monarchy with King Harald V as the head of state. The country has a population of 5,425,270 as of January 2022. Norway is a relatively small country and has a relatively low population density, with much of its land area covered by forests, mountains, and fjords. Despite its small size, Norway is known for its rich cultural heritage, strong economy, and stunning natural beauty, which attracts millions of visitors every year. This Nordic country is also known for its winter sports, such as skiing and snowboarding, and is a popular destination for outdoor enthusiasts.

Norway has a long history of invention and is home to numerous more top-tier tech firms and research facilities, such as; Kongsberg Gruppen, Telenor, Atea, Evry and Gjensidige Forsikring.

Due to the country's high latitude, there are large seasonal variations in daylight. From late May to late July, the sun never completely descends beneath the horizon.
